Can someone with more time confirm if his Uncle Nick really ran against Jesse Helms in North Carolina in 1972? And if the slogan used to disparage him was real and had a substantial effect on the outcome? posted by lazaruslong at 10:44 AM on November 13, 2007
Let's see. There are plenty of corroborating news stories, mentioning the innuendo of the Greek surname being alien, but of course we'll never know how much effect Helms' invective had. The outcome was 54% to 46%. posted by Ambrosia Voyeur at 10:54 AM on November 13, 2007
